Meeting of the European Council

Thu, 06/28/2012 to Fri, 06/29/2012
The European Council brings together the Heads of State or Government of all the EU Member States, i.e. Prime Ministers or Presidents, as well as the President of the European Council and the President of the Commission.
 
The European Council is convened twice every six months, typically in March, June, October and December. However, the President of the European Council can also convene extraordinary meetings.
 

Meeting of General Affairs Council (GAC)

Tue, 06/26/2012

In the General Affairs Council (GAC) the ministers coordinates the preparation of and follow-up on meetings in the European Council and covers dossiers of cross-cutting nature, thus affecting more than one EU policies - including negotiations on EU enlargement, preparation of the EU's multiannual financial frameworks and institutional and administrative matters. The council typically meets once a month and the Member States are represented by either their Minister of Foreign or European Affairs.
